The global industrial landscape for non-metal laser cutting systems has seen a monumental shift over the last decade. Historically, laser technology was predominantly associated with heavy metal fabrication. However, the rise of the electronics, semiconductor, and medical device industries has catapulted the demand for precision cutting of non-metallic materials like ceramics, silicon steel, polymers, and advanced composites.

Global procurement teams are no longer just looking for the cheapest machine; they seek reliability, local technical support, and modularity. Here is how non-metal laser systems are applied in key global markets:
Cutting synthetic leathers, fabrics, and composite dashboard materials with zero fraying. Our CO2 systems offer perfectly sealed edges for premium car manufacturers.
Precision etching of PCBs and cutting of ceramic substrates. Systems like the EtherCAT PCB Etching CCD Controller are vital for smartphone and IoT device assembly.
High-speed acrylic cutting. The ZY72B8G-2000 control system ensures crystal-clear edges on thick acrylics, eliminating the need for secondary flame polishing.
